Orchard Crash Rewrites the Zcash Price Prediction Outlook

A soundness flaw in Zcash’s Orchard zero knowledge proof circuit, present since May 2022, was discovered on May 29 during a Shielded Labs audit, according to BitMEX. The vulnerability could have allowed undetectable counterfeit ZEC minting, and though no exploitation occurred, the disclosure triggered a 50% crash from $624 to roughly $309 within two days.

An emergency hard fork on June 3 patched the circuit and re-enabled shielded transactions, according to Coinpedia. Over $200 million in ZEC left the Orchard pool as Arthur Hayes publicly exited his position.

Zcash

ZEC is trading near $500 after recovering roughly 60% from the June 5 low of $309, and the bounce shows the core community still believes in the privacy thesis. On chain data confirms the shielded pool lost over 500,000 ZEC during the panic, but deposits have started returning as the patch holds, according to Coinpedia. The Ironwood upgrade planned for July targets a 300% throughput improvement and quantum recoverability.
